unstring
definition
un·string (-striŋ′)
transitive verb unstrung -·strung′, unstringing -·string′·ing
- to loosen or remove the string or strings of
- to remove from a string
- to loosen; relax
- to cause to be unstrung; make nervous, weak, upset, etc.
